news 2026/5/6 16:53:15

qBittorrent搜索插件太弱?手把手教你用Jackett API Key打通400+中英文资源站(附代理避坑指南)

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
qBittorrent搜索插件太弱?手把手教你用Jackett API Key打通400+中英文资源站(附代理避坑指南)

解锁qBittorrent搜索潜能:Jackett API深度整合与资源站拓展实战

在数字资源获取领域,效率往往决定着体验的优劣。当我们谈论BT客户端时,qBittorrent以其开源免费、无广告的特性赢得了大量用户的青睐。但许多资深用户发现,其内置的搜索插件在面对中文资源时显得力不从心——支持的站点有限,搜索结果单一,这成为了影响使用体验的明显短板。

1. 为什么需要Jackett作为搜索增强方案

qBittorrent原生的搜索插件系统基于Python脚本实现,虽然允许用户自行添加各类搜索引擎,但存在几个关键问题:中文资源站支持稀少、插件维护不及时、搜索结果聚合能力弱。这些问题直接导致了用户仍需频繁访问各类资源网站手动搜索,再回到客户端进行下载,流程繁琐且效率低下。

Jackett的出现完美解决了这些痛点。作为一款专业的资源搜索中间件,它聚合了全球超过400个公开、半公开及私有资源站的搜索接口,其中包含大量中文资源站点。通过统一的API接口,Jackett能够:

  • 标准化搜索体验:将不同站点的搜索语法统一为简单一致的API调用
  • 跨平台支持:无论是Windows、macOS还是Linux系统均可无缝使用
  • 实时更新机制:索引器列表持续维护,避免因站点改版导致搜索失效
  • 多语言覆盖:特别优化了中文资源的搜索体验和结果呈现

更关键的是,Jackett与qBittorrent有着天然的兼容性。两者结合后,用户可以直接在qBittorrent界面中搜索到来自数百个站点的资源,无需再在各个网站间来回切换,真正实现"一站式搜索下载"的工作流。

2. Jackett服务部署与基础配置

2.1 多种安装方式对比

Jackett提供了灵活的部署方案,适合不同技术背景的用户:

安装方式适用场景技术要求维护难度
Docker容器推荐方案,隔离性好,升级方便中等
原生系统包适合单一系统长期使用
便携版(Windows)免安装,即开即用最低

对于大多数用户,我们推荐使用Docker部署,这不仅保证了环境隔离,也简化了后续的升级流程。以下是标准的Docker Compose配置示例:

version: "3.8" services: jackett: image: lscr.io/linuxserver/jackett:latest container_name: jackett environment: - PUID=1000 - PGID=1000 - TZ=Asia/Shanghai - AUTO_UPDATE=true volumes: - ./config:/config - ./downloads:/downloads ports: - 9117:9117 restart: unless-stopped

关键配置说明:

  • AUTO_UPDATE=true确保自动获取最新版本
  • /config卷保存所有配置数据和索引器信息
  • 时区设置为亚洲/上海保证日志时间准确

2.2 初始设置与安全加固

首次访问Web界面(通常为http://服务器IP:9117)后,应当立即进行以下安全设置:

  1. 修改管理员密码:在Server Configuration中设置强密码,特别是服务暴露在公网时
  2. 配置访问限制:通过Advanced Settings中的Admin Whitelist限制管理界面访问IP
  3. 启用HTTPS:准备SSL证书后,在Server Configuration中开启安全连接

重要提示:如果Jackett服务需要通过公网访问,务必同时配置防火墙规则,仅开放必要的9117端口,并考虑使用反向代理增加安全性。

3. 索引器管理与API关键配置

3.1 添加和优化中文资源索引器

Jackett的强大之处在于其丰富的索引器支持。添加索引器时,建议重点关注以下类型的中文资源站:

  • 影视综合类:如Zooqle、TorrentKitty等
  • 高清专攻类:适合追求蓝光原盘的用户
  • 动漫专项类:包含大量连载动画资源
  • 电子书/学术类:涵盖PDF、EPUB等格式

添加索引器的实用技巧:

  1. 使用搜索框过滤中文站点,输入"chinese"或直接使用中文关键词
  2. 关注Health状态指标,优先选择100%健康的索引器
  3. 合理使用Categories筛选,减少不相关结果
  4. 对响应慢的站点,在Configure中调整Timeout参数

3.2 API密钥的获取与安全使用

API Key是连接qBittorrent与Jackett的桥梁,位于Server Configuration页面顶部。这个密钥相当于访问所有搜索功能的万能钥匙,因此需要妥善保管:

  1. 定期轮换密钥:通过Flush Jackett API Key按钮生成新密钥
  2. 访问控制:在Advanced Settings中配置API Whitelist
  3. 用量监控:通过/api/v2.0/stats端点跟踪API调用情况

典型的API调用示例:

http://localhost:9117/api/v2.0/indexers/all/results?apikey=您的密钥&Query=搜索关键词

4. qBittorrent深度整合实战

4.1 配置文件手动修改方案

虽然qBittorrent内置了Jackett插件,但默认配置往往需要调整才能发挥最大效用。配置文件通常位于:

~/.config/qBittorrent/nova3/engines/jackett.json (Linux) %APPDATA%\qBittorrent\nova3\engines\jackett.json (Windows)

需要修改的关键参数包括:

{ "api_key": "替换为实际API密钥", "tracker_first": false, "url": "http://jackett服务器IP:9117", "limit": 100, "timeout": 60 }

参数说明:

  • tracker_first:设为false以获得更多结果
  • limit:控制每次返回的结果数量
  • timeout:适当增加可改善高延迟站点的搜索成功率

4.2 验证与性能调优

配置完成后,通过以下步骤验证集成是否成功:

  1. 在qBittorrent中启用Jackett插件
  2. 执行测试搜索,观察结果数量和多样性
  3. 检查日志文件排除错误

性能优化建议:

  • 对于结果过多的查询,添加Categories参数缩小范围
  • 网络延迟高时,适当增加timeout
  • 定期检查并移除响应慢或失效的索引器

5. 网络优化与高级技巧

5.1 连接稳定性提升方案

在实际使用中,网络连接质量直接影响搜索体验。我们推荐几种经过验证的优化方法:

缓存策略优化

  • 调整Jackett的Cache Timeout(默认15分钟)
  • 对热门查询启用结果预加载
  • 使用内存缓存加速重复查询

连接参数调优

# 在Jackett的config文件中添加 [Network] MaxConnections=50 ConnectionTimeout=30

5.2 搜索效率提升技巧

  1. 高级搜索语法

    • 使用ANDOR组合关键词
    • 通过-排除不想要的结果
    • 指定文件大小范围如size:1GB-5GB
  2. 自动化方案

    • 与Sonarr/Radarr集成实现自动下载
    • 设置RSS订阅自动获取最新资源
    • 使用IFTTT或自定义脚本实现搜索自动化
  3. 结果排序策略

    • 按种子数量排序获取最活跃资源
    • 按文件大小排序找到最适合的版本
    • 按发布时间排序获取最新资源

经过这些优化后,你将获得一个响应迅速、结果全面的超级搜索系统,无论是热门大片还是冷门资源,都能快速定位并开始下载。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/4 17:37:27

通过 curl 命令快速测试 Taotoken API 密钥与接口连通性

通过 curl 命令快速测试 Taotoken API 密钥与接口连通性 1. 准备工作 在开始测试之前,请确保已获取有效的 Taotoken API 密钥。登录 Taotoken 控制台,在「API 密钥」页面可以创建和管理密钥。同时确认本地环境已安装 curl 工具,大多数 Linu…

作者头像 李华
网站建设 2026/5/4 17:34:32

炉石传说macOS智能助手HSTracker:让每一局对战都拥有数据分析师

炉石传说macOS智能助手HSTracker:让每一局对战都拥有数据分析师 【免费下载链接】HSTracker A deck tracker and deck manager for Hearthstone on macOS 项目地址: https://gitcode.com/gh_mirrors/hs/HSTracker 还在为记不住对手卡牌而苦恼?是否…

作者头像 李华
网站建设 2026/5/6 3:16:43

2025届必备的五大AI论文方案横评

Ai论文网站排名(开题报告、文献综述、降aigc率、降重综合对比) TOP1. 千笔AI TOP2. aipasspaper TOP3. 清北论文 TOP4. 豆包 TOP5. kimi TOP6. deepseek 随着人工智能技术朝着更为深入的方向发展,“一键生成论文”已然变成学术写作辅助…

作者头像 李华
网站建设 2026/5/4 17:23:41

GSE高级宏编译器:实现自动化游戏操作的模块化架构方案

GSE高级宏编译器:实现自动化游戏操作的模块化架构方案 【免费下载链接】GSE-Advanced-Macro-Compiler GSE is an alternative advanced macro editor and engine for World of Warcraft. 项目地址: https://gitcode.com/gh_mirrors/gs/GSE-Advanced-Macro-Compil…

作者头像 李华